Thauria aliris
Species of butterfly From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Thauria aliris, the tufted jungleking,[1] is a butterfly found in South East Asia that belongs to the Morphinae subfamily of the brush-footed butterflies family.

Distribution

The tufted jungleking ranges among Myanmar, Malaysia, Borneo and Tonkin.[1][2]
Status
In 1932, William Harry Evans reported the butterfly as very rare in northern Myanmar.[2]
